About Natalie

Natalie Jones is a Licensed Independent Clinical Social Worker (LICSW) with 18 years of experience. She shifted into social work after a long career in business and now focuses on helping people manage stress, anxiety, depression, addiction, trauma, and relationship concerns. Natalie keeps sessions straightforward and practical.

She listens first and then works with each person to set realistic goals. She can be direct when needed but pairs that with gentleness and respect.

How Natalie works

Her background includes more than a decade of delivering in-home support to individuals and families. That work involved emotional support, guidance, and hands-on help for people facing childhood trauma, substance use issues, grief, and caregiving strain. In sessions she draws on client-centered methods, cognitive behavioral tools, emotionally-focused techniques, mindfulness, and motivational interviewing.

She adapts interventions to match each person's strengths and situation rather than using a one-size-fits-all plan. Natalie values honest, nonjudgmental relationships. She emphasizes listening and building trust so people feel safe to talk about difficult feelings.

Over time she helps people change unhelpful patterns, improve communication, and build coping skills for life changes and parenting challenges.

Therapeutic approaches adapted for online sessions

Client-centered therapy focuses on understanding each person's experience and building a trusting relationship. The therapist listens without judgment and helps people identify goals and strengths to guide the work.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) teaches practical tools to notice unhelpful thoughts and try different behaviors, which can reduce anxiety, depression, and problematic patterns. Emotionally-focused therapy (EFT) helps people recognize and name emotions and improve how they connect and communicate in relationships, which can reduce conflict and increase closeness.

Choosing the right approach is part of the process. The therapist will talk with each person about their goals and preferences and then recommend methods that fit. That collaborative process means plans can change as needs evolve, and techniques are picked to match what is most helpful for the individual.

Online sessions are offered by licensed professionals using video calls, phone sessions, live chat, or text-based messaging. Video allows a fuller conversation and visual cues, phone sessions can be easier when bandwidth is limited, live chat and text work well for quick check-ins or when typing feels more comfortable. These options give flexibility to fit therapy into work breaks, caregiving schedules, or other busy days while keeping the focus on practical skills and emotional support.
